If you've never spilled an ice cube tray full of water or accidentally dumped a dozen cubes on the floor, I hope you have the medal you deserve. For the rest of us, a clever, covered ice cube tray like this could be a cool solution.

Designed by black+blum, the awkwardly-named "brrrr" tray takes an extremely hands off approach to ice cubes. The tray fills vertically, with a small run-off spout to prevent going over. Then, once you plug the cap and throw it in the freezer horizontally, the water flows out into the hollow legs. And when all is said and done, you just grab your mutant 10-legged polar bear-ipede and smack him on the counter to loosen the cubes that'll fall out of his mouth.

Sure, it wouldn't be easy to refill one of these before it's totally empty, or even see how many cubes are left inside, but it's an interesting new twist on a pretty stale piece of kitchen tech. It's only a concept for now, but hopefully development won't get frozen before it can hit shelves. [Yanko Design]
